Discover "business opportunities" at work.

On August 20 15, Xu Yanqin came to work in a company called Internet, which actually sold paid software for searching personal information. These softwares are powerful, which can collect and integrate a large number of personal information of citizens such as names and telephone numbers from the Internet, and also sort out the information.

After working for a period of time, Xu Yanqin gradually became familiar with the routine, so he wanted to go out and sell software himself. After that, Xu Yanqin submitted his resignation and prepared to start a business. First, she borrowed a company's "empty shell" from a friend and rented a house in an office building in jiande city, Zhejiang. After that, she found two software companies that had done business before, acting as agents and selling the software for searching personal information to a number of financial companies.

Only a week later, Xu Yanqin found that many companies were not interested in software, but bought personal information directly from Xu Yanqin. Therefore, Xu Yanqin decided to sell personal information directly and began to form a company team. Soon, Shao, Zhou, Ye and others joined in. After the establishment of the company, Xu Yanqin was afraid that employees didn't understand sales, so he carefully prepared a speech to teach them communication and sales skills. In order to satisfy customers, Xu Yanqin uses the network to detect the downloaded telephone numbers, eliminating the empty numbers and downtime, so as to improve the "gold content" of information.

Unlike hackers who usually crack citizens' personal information accounts, Xu Yanqin and others mostly obtain personal information through software search, which has been made public on the Internet. According to the prosecutor of Chongchuan District Procuratorate, according to the provisions of the Ninth Amendment to the Criminal Law of China, selling or providing citizens' personal information to others in violation of relevant state regulations, if the circumstances are serious, constitutes a crime of infringing citizens' personal information. Xu Yanqin and others search and sort out public information on the Internet through software, which is relatively harmless, but if they sell it in large quantities, they have already violated the criminal law.
